What is an Agency Ad Account?
Simply put, an agency account is an advertising account that has been created specifically by the business manager of a trusted, official partner agency of Meta.

These accounts are different from standard accounts you can create yourself for a few reasons:- They can receive cashback on advertising spend.

- They are trusted, and much less likely to get restricted.
- They do not have spending limits or require a warmup phase.
- You get a dedicated rep for support from the platform.
- You can get an auction advantage and cheaper results.
- An unlimited amount of them can be created by the agency.

Discussion CPA jumped 50% overnight. The product didn't change. Here's what did.

Upvotes

This is one of the most common messages I get from ecommerce founders and it's rarely one single cause.

Here's how I actually approach it:

When CPA spikes suddenly on previously-stable products, I check these in order:

→ Frequency; is the same audience seeing the ad too often? A spike here means the account is exhausting its pool, not that demand dropped

→ Audience overlap; did a new ad set get added that's now competing with the winning ones for the same people

→ Creative fatigue; how long has the current creative been running without a refresh

→ CPM movement; did the cost to reach people rise
(seasonal/competition), or did conversion rate drop while CPM stayed flat

→ Landing page/funnel; sometimes the ad is fine and the drop is actually happening after the click

The process:

Pull frequency + overlap data first cheapest, fastest checks

Compare CPM trend vs. conversion rate trend separately tells you if it's a traffic-cost problem or a funnel problem

Isolate the winning products into their own campaign if they're being diluted by overlap

Refresh creative before touching budget don't scale blind into a fatigued ad
90% of the time, it's one of these not a "the algorithm broke" situation.
